- 鳥追い【とりおい】鳥追
noun:
- driving off birds
- procession held at the New Year to chase away the birds for the year, with children singing songs as the villagers walked from house to house
- female street musician who wore a braided hat and carried a shamisen
- street entertainer who appeared on New Year's eve and performed with a fan

- 薬食い【くすりぐい】
noun:
- winter-time practice of eating meat of animals such as boar and deer to ward off cold
